研究概览

简要总结

This Phase 1 study consists of two parts, all conducted in healthy volunteers (HVs).

In Part 1, the drug-drug interaction (DDI) potential of ALG-000184 will be explored with Itraconazole; participants will be assigned to receive multiple doses of ALG-000184 and Itraconazole over a two week period.

In Part 2, the drug-drug interaction (DDI) potential of ALG-000184 will be explored with Carbamazepine; participants will be assigned to receive multiple doses of ALG-000184 and ascending doses of Carbamazepine over an 18 day period.

The 2 parts may be conducted in parallel.

研究组 & 干预措施

ALG-000184

Experimental

Single or multiple doses of ALG-000184, an investigational HBV capsid assembly modulator

干预措施: ALG-000184 (Drug)

Carbamazepine

Experimental

Multiple doses of carbamazepine, a strong CYP3A4 inducer, to evaluate potential drug-drug interactions with ALG-000184

干预措施: Carbamazepine (Drug)

Carbamazepine

Experimental

Multiple doses of carbamazepine, a strong CYP3A4 inducer, to evaluate potential drug-drug interactions with ALG-000184

干预措施: ALG-000184 (Drug)

Itraconazole

Experimental

Multiple doses of itraconazole, a strong CYP3A4 inhibitor, to evaluate potential drug-drug interactions with ALG-000184.

干预措施: Itraconazole (Sporanox) (Drug)
